Understanding Sleep Apnea Research Landscape
Sleep apnea affects millions of Americans, with research continuously evolving to address both obstructive and central sleep apnea variants. Clinical trials in the United States follow strict protocols established by institutional review boards to ensure participant safety and scientific validity. Current studies often focus on innovative CPAP alternatives, hypoglossal nerve stimulation, and pharmaceutical interventions that target the neurological aspects of breathing regulation during sleep.
The recruitment process typically involves multiple screening stages, including comprehensive sleep studies and medical history reviews. Participants should be aware that sleep apnea clinical trials near me searches may yield both academic medical centers and private research facilities, each with different inclusion criteria and study durations. Most trials require participants to maintain detailed sleep diaries and attend regular monitoring appointments, which can span several months to years depending on the intervention being tested.
Key Considerations for Potential Participants
Eligibility Requirements vary significantly between studies but commonly include specific apnea-hypopnea index (AHI) ranges, body mass index parameters, and previous treatment responses. Many trials exclude individuals with certain cardiovascular conditions or those taking medications that could interfere with sleep architecture. FDA-approved device trials often have more stringent criteria than behavioral or pharmaceutical studies.
Financial aspects deserve careful attention. While many research programs cover all study-related medical costs, participants should clarify whether compensation is provided for time and travel expenses. Some sleep apnea research studies offer modest stipends, while others only provide free treatments and monitoring. It's essential to discuss payment structures during the initial screening process and understand any potential out-of-pocket costs.
Current Research Focus Areas
Recent trials have expanded beyond traditional positive airway pressure devices to include oral appliance therapy advancements, positional therapy devices, and combination treatments that address multiple aspects of the disorder. Neuromodulation approaches showing promise include hypoglossal nerve stimulation implants that activate tongue muscles during inspiration, preventing airway collapse. Pharmaceutical research explores medications that enhance respiratory drive or reduce upper airway inflammation.
Pediatric sleep apnea trials represent a growing segment, focusing on adenotonsillectomy alternatives and growth-friendly orthodontic devices. Meanwhile, geriatric-focused research examines how sleep apnea treatment might mitigate cognitive decline in older adults. The table below outlines common trial types available in the United States:
| Trial Category | Typical Duration | Participant Requirements | Potential Benefits | Common Locations |
|---|
| Device Interventions | 3-12 months | Moderate-severe OSA, CPAP intolerance | Access to advanced technology | Academic medical centers |
| Pharmaceutical Studies | 1-6 months | Mild-moderate apnea, stable health | Novel medication options | Research hospitals |
| Behavioral Therapies | 2-9 months | All severity levels, motivation for lifestyle changes | Non-invasive approaches | University sleep clinics |
| Surgical Interventions | 12-24 months | Severe OSA, anatomical factors | Potential permanent solution | Specialty surgical centers |
Practical Steps for Participation
Begin by consulting with your sleep physician about appropriate trial opportunities that align with your specific condition and treatment history. Reputable sources for identifying current sleep apnea clinical trials include ClinicalTrials.gov, university sleep centers, and professional organizations like the American Academy of Sleep Medicine. When evaluating potential studies, consider the principal investigator's experience, the institution's reputation, and the trial's phase (Phase I-IV indicates progressively larger participant groups and refined safety data).
Before committing, thoroughly review the informed consent documents with your personal physician and ensure you understand the protocol requirements, potential risks, and time commitments. Legitimate studies will always provide clear explanations of your rights as a participant and maintain confidentiality protocols according to HIPAA regulations. Many research institutions offer patient navigators who can help explain technical aspects and connect you with previous participants for firsthand perspectives.
